The Butter modular sofa is designed by Faye Toogood for Tacchini with wooden frame padded with polyurethane foam in varying densities and a seat cushion filled with hypoallergenic fiber, all upholstered in fabric.
Butter is a modular sofa that stands out as an irresistibly soft and sculptural furnishing element, capable of transforming any space with its enveloping and sensorial presence. Its padding, as smooth as freshly churned Cornish butter, expands into generous, building block–like volumes, offering the freedom to compose and reconfigure the seating with creative ease.
In designing this piece, Faye Toogood sought to capture the gentle, everyday act of shaping cold butter straight from the fridge—an intimate, tactile experience. “I wanted to create a seat as comfortable and tactile as butter, and the Butter sofa was born by moulding soft butter with slippery fingers,” she explains.
